As part of my masters capstone project, I traveled down to Charleston, South Carolina, to work as a festival reporter for the Pulitzer Prize winning newspaper, The Post and Courier. I researched, pitched, and wrote stories about national and international artists coming to the Spoleto Festival USA as well as the Piccolo Spoleto Festival—a smaller, local arts festival. I wrote advancers, features and reviews and tried to incorporate multimedia elements whenever possible. Below is a list of my published works from this experience.
